Learning management system as a tool for online knowledge evaluation in an engineering course during the COVID-19 pandemic

Аннотация

Disrupted by the COVID-19 pandemic, the 2019/20 academic year brought an unplanned shift to education online. While teaching itself became more challenging, the main disruption was in testing, where not being in the same room with students whose knowledge was being evaluated posed serious challenges. This paper discusses the approach taken by the lecturers of the course “Fundamentals of electrical engineering” in professional study of electrical engineering at the Zagreb University of Applied Sciences. The paper examines the important role of a properly set up Learning management system for knowledge evaluation and compares the unproctored online approach to the typical proctored exam.
